Old Overholt 11 Year Rye

Distillery - Jim Beam Distilling

MSRP - $97

Proof - 107.4

Age - 11 Years

Mashbill - Undisclosed

Tasting Notes

  • Nose – A mix of leather and oak, rounded out by a soft, yeasty bread-dough note.

  • Palate – Green apple, black pepper, nutmeg spice.

  • Finish – A warm, lightly sweet finish that trails off into classic rye spice.

Food Pairing – Broccoli Cheddar Soup

  • We didn’t plan for this pairing, but it ended up being one of those comforting, cold-weather combinations that just makes sense. The soup’s creamy cheddar mellowed the rye’s spice, and every sip brought out more warmth and richness. But the real surprise was how the rye’s green apple note lifted the bite — it added a brightness that kept the pairing from feeling too heavy and made the flavors feel connected.

Nav and Katie’s Thoughts

  • If you’re already into rye, this is an easy pour to love — it’s got that warm spice and depth you expect from an 11-year bottle. But even if you’re more of a bourbon drinker, this is one of the friendlier ryes out there. It’s balanced, approachable, and never tries to overpower you. With a little time in the glass, the peppery note softens and you start getting more of the fruit and oak notes, giving the pour a smooth, well-rounded feel.
